Bunch of refactoring

- Get rid of KeyProfile and use DatabaseEntry directly
- Don't store Google auth style urls in the db, but use separate fields
- Update testdata to reflect db format changes
- Lay the ground work for HOTP support
- Refactor KeyInfo and split it into OtpInfo, TotpInto and HotpInfo
- Surely some other stuff I forgot about
